»Laughing and joking«

Easter is a festival of joy. It is no coincidence that the custom of Easter laughter has existed since the Middle Ages: in his sermon, the priest tried to make the churchgoers laugh. Echoes of this can also be found in Johann Sebastian Bach's solemn »Easter Oratorio« BWV 249, which opens with the words »Laughter and Jokes« with lively melismas. The Constellation Choir & Orchestra place it at the centre of their concert on the Wednesday after the Easter weekend. The cantata »Der Himmel lacht, die Erde jubiliert« BWV 31, also intended for Easter Sunday, will open the concert. These two works are grouped around the cantata for Easter Monday »Bleib bei uns, denn es will Abend werden« BWV 6, which in contrast is of a contemplative nature. The conductor is Sir John Eliot Gardiner, one of the most distinguished Bach interpreters of our time, whose many years of experience and stylistic precision characterise this evening.
